Exclusion Criteria
1) Subjects who are diagnosed taste disturbance 2) Subjects who received chemotherapy within the past one year 3) Subjects who have been performed the dietary therapy for hypertension such as sodium restriction 4) Subjects who are assessed by the principal investigator due to other reasons

- Primary Outcome Measures
Name Time Method The result of Touch panel-type Dementia Assessment Scale (TDAS) just after intervention.
- Secondary Outcome Measures
Name Time Method The results of Gottfries, Brane and Steen scale (GBSS), questionnaire and blood tests just after intervention.
